Course Overview: This is an introduction course on how thermal systems work. It is a practical approach of many of the mechanical system that relies on thermal energy for many applications within the industries. Thermal energy is the most particular use in many areas and in particular mechanical engineering discipline. Heat and work is the most effective form of energy that can be used or produced in many different ways in order to service and provide the humankind a better and safe life.
These types of systems appear in many industries such as power generation, refrigeration, air conditioning and heating, and in the food, chemical and process industries. The principles of thermodynamic, heat transfer and fluid mechanics must be implemented in order to understand and calculate the performance and efficiency of the thermal system.
